Chapter II describes a spectrophotometric method has been described for the quantitative analysis of uranyl ion in soil samples. The method is based on the chelation of uranyl ion with piroxicam to produce a yellow coloured complex in 1,4- dioxane-water medium at room temperature which absorbs maximally at 390 nm. Beer s law is obeyed in the concentration range of 6.75 × 10-2 9.45 × 10-1 µg mL-1 with apparent molar absorptivity and Sandell s sensitivity of 4.114 × 105 L mol-1cm-1 and 0.00066 and#61549;g/cm2/ 0.001 absorbance unit, respectively. | en_US |
